Output 17fefb66a4dfddf8a8a110d835b43aeb2afc5b124861dd96d19f9bc911e2603c:11

value
88224461
script pubkey
OP_0 OP_PUSHBYTES_32 ae6af6bb1a693b2dcfaf0af39389138753a45b0226d786e54aa824de2679fcd5
address
bc1q4e40dwc6dyajmna0ptee8zgnsaf6gkczymtcde224qjdufneln2s5f504f
transaction
17fefb66a4dfddf8a8a110d835b43aeb2afc5b124861dd96d19f9bc911e2603c
spent
true